Big Appetite in Little Tokyo is the first episode of the second season of What's New, Scooby-Doo?, and the fifteenth episode overall in the series.
Premise
Shaggy becomes Tokyo's most wanted when it's believed he can transform into a 30 ft Godzilla-like monster after accidently eating a cursed pizza.

Suspects
Suspect | Motive/reason |
---|---|
Shaggy Rogers | He was cursed to turn into a monster. The monster looked like him. |
Elliott Blender | He lost again to Velma's invention. He followed the gang to Tokyo. |
Culprits
Culprit | Motive/reason |
---|---|
Professor Pomfrit piloting the 30 Foot Shaggy robot | Framed Shaggy, out of jealousy of Onodera's wealth. |
Dogbot | Programmed by Pomfrit. It was used to chew though Shaggy's chains so it would look like he broke loose, and to transport Shaggy. |

Notes/trivia
- The "meddling kids" line of the episode is given to Lt. Tanaka, as the villain apologized for his actions.
Cultural references
- The episode title is an allusion to the cult film, Big Trouble in Little China.
- This episode is a homage to Godzilla.

Home media
- What's New Scooby-Doo?: Volume 6 - Monster Matinee DVD released by Warner Home Video on August 9, 2005.
- What's New, Scooby-Doo?: Complete 2nd Season DVD set released by Warner Home Video on June 7, 2007.
- Scooby-Doo! 13 Spooky Tales: For the Love of Snack DVD set released by Warner Home Video on January 7, 2014.
